What you need to know first, explained simply

AI content automation is a set of tools and workflows that let you plan, draft, edit, and publish content with far less manual effort. You are not replacing humans. You are scaling repeatable tasks like outline generation, research aggregation, and schema creation. When you pair those tools with human review, you get speed and control.

Generative Engine Optimization, or GEO, is the set of techniques that make your content more likely to be used by answer engines and large language models. GEO emphasizes short, precise answers, modular content blocks, and provenance. These signals improve your chance of being quoted or cited by systems that synthesize content for users. How to bridge classic SEO and generative needs

You maintain classic SEO fundamentals, and add GEO primitives. That means continue to care about backlinks, crawlability, and on-page intent, then layer in short answer snippets, compact FAQ modules, and explicit citations. A clear framework helps you prioritize both.

Intent mapping for GEO

Instead of only targeting long-tail keywords, identify short-answer prompts that users or LLMs ask. Cluster queries into direct-answer opportunities. For example, convert a 1,800 word guide into a pillar page with eight modular QA blocks. Those QA blocks are perfect for GEO.

What the leaders are doing, and how you out-execute them

Leaders use a One Company Model. Capture company voice, buyer personas, approved facts, and tone in a single source of truth. Every AI agent reads that model before generating content. This prevents inconsistent messaging and reduces hallucination risk.

They also instrument content for machine retrieval. That means granular schema, explicit short answers, and modular content that can be pulled into an answer engine without needing the whole article. Add provenance by linking to primary research, and create resource pages that act as citation hubs.

Finally, implement human-in-the-loop reviews that focus on accuracy, high-quality content, and legal risk when a topic touches YMYL. That balance of automation and oversight is how you scale without losing trust.

The SEO + GEO Strategy Framework

A step-by-step roadmap you can follow now

  • Step 1, audit technical and content posture. Run a crawl and identify indexation issues. Map pages that already capture featured snippets and People Also Ask questions. Track Core Web Vitals and remove heavy client-side render blocks.
  • Step 2, build a One Company Model. Document ICP details, tone, product facts, and banned claims. Store this centrally so your AI agents always use the same context.
  • Step 3, map keywords for answers and authority. Cluster by intent and identify ten high-value answer queries per pillar. Prioritize those that match buyer intent and can convert.
  • Step 4, design content architecture. Use pillar pages for depth and QA or FAQ pages for short-answer capture. Create citation pages that consolidate original data. These pages act as authoritative sources for AI engines.
  • Step 5, create content with AI agents and human review. Use AI to draft, to fetch citations, and to generate schema.   • Step 6, apply on-page optimization and schema. Implement Article, FAQ, QAPage, BreadcrumbList, and Organization structured data where appropriate. Make short answers obvious, under question headings, so that a retrieval system can extract them.
  • Step 7, execute link and reference strategy. Link internally to pillar hubs and externally to primary sources. LLMs and answer engines prefer content that cites durable sources.
  • Step 8, measure, iterate, scale. Track classic ranking metrics and GEO signals. Sample generative answers to see if your site gets cited verbatim.

How this framework prevents common failures

Many teams either over-automate, or under-scale. You will avoid both. If you over-automate without review, you risk factual errors. If you rely on manual production, you lose the velocity needed to cover answer space. This framework forces both automation and human verification.

Technical And On-Page Checklist

A practical list to implement on every asset

  • Meta title and description optimized for question intent and click rate
  • H1 and H2 structure that includes direct questions
  • Concise short answer block near the top, 40 to 70 words, with clear citation
  • FAQ or QAPage schema with relevant questions and answers
  • Article schema with datePublished and dateModified
  • Breadcrumbs and consistent URL structure
  • HTML text for main content, avoid heavy JS-only rendering
  • Descriptive alt text for images
  • Internal links to pillar pages and resource hubs
  • Fast load times and mobile-first layout to satisfy Core Web Vitals

Risk Management And EEAT Safeguards

How to keep automation honest

Insist on human review, especially for claims that affect finances, health, or legal outcomes. Use primary-source citations to reduce hallucinations. Publish author bylines with credentials. For YMYL content, add expert reviewer sign-off. Keep an update log and flag stale pages. These measures protect your brand and search performance.

FAQ

Q: What is the main difference between SEO and GEO?

A: SEO optimizes for traditional ranking signals like backlinks, on-page relevance, and user experience. GEO optimizes for answer engines and LLMs by focusing on modular answers, explicit citations, and machine-readable structure. You should retain classic SEO while adding GEO primitives. That hybrid approach increases your chance of both clicks and zero-click answers.

Q: Can AI content automation replace writers?

A: No, it should not replace skilled writers. Use automation to speed research, generate outlines, and produce drafts. Human writers and editors add nuance, verification, and brand voice. The best teams pair AI efficiency with human judgment to scale while protecting quality.

Q: How quickly will GEO tactics produce visible results?

A: You may see small wins, like PAA captures or snippet entries, in 30 to 45 days. Larger authority gains take months, because backlinks, trust, and topical authority build over time. Treat early wins as signals you iterate on, not as endpoints.

Q: What are the most effective GEO technical steps to implement first?

A: Start with FAQ or QAPage schema, short answer boxes under question headings, and clean Article schema with dateModified. Ensure HTML text is visible to crawlers and that pages load quickly on mobile. Those steps give immediate improvement in how machines discover and reuse your content.

Q: How do you prevent AI hallucination in published content?

A: Require primary-source citations for factual claims. Implement a review checklist focused on verification. Use AI to surface sources, but have an editor validate them. Track revision history and publish update notes to maintain transparency.
